I had it with a 22 month gap and used it for about a year so DC1 was nearly 3 in it and perfectly comfortable. I didn't think the seats were narrow at all but overall it is so it fits on all buses etc. It's like magic!

Holds its value too. We bought ours secondhand for £200 and sold it thirdhand for £150.

My god I LOVED my duet, hands down best pram I ever had - wish I’d bought one to start off with and used it with the side basket as then I could have pushed it forever 😭😭. It fitted 91st centile DD up to 3.5 absolutely no bother. The carrycots are tiny but I actually liked that, I had a single bugaboo and the carrycot was ENORMOUS, totally impractical and not at all cosy. I miss it still even though DDs are 7 and 4 now 😅.

The basket is adequate. It’s probably larger than most doubles but ours (second hand so an old model) has a strap across the middle which makes it quite awkward, and the fabric has ripped from being forced to hold too much. My single Uppababy has way more space underneath. Yes, I do have 3 buggies plus a bike trailer/running buggy for two children 😂 Overall as a double I do love it and would totally recommend.
